Minibuffers
***********

   A "minibuffer" is a special buffer that Emacs commands use to read
arguments more complicated than the single numeric prefix argument.
These arguments include file names, buffer names, and command names (as
in `M-x').  The minibuffer is displayed on the bottom line of the
frame, in the same place as the echo area, but only while it is in use
for reading an argument.
